Art Nouveau is an art movement from the late 1800s through the early 1900s that used anything from nature as inspiration. Louis Comfort Tiffany's stained glass work is used as an example of flowing, organic lines and forms. Use feathers, flowers, shells and insects to inspire your art students to create an Art Nouveau style line drawing in colored pencil. ages 9+Student example: https://drive.google.com/file/d/1r73x8SLx7JqjOeGaLs77WAYNHQtg7zdL/view?usp=sharing
